Is there a hole in the 'eccentric' part? If there is, stick a small allen wrench in that hole and rotate the cranks around until they push/pull the eccentric by hitting that allen wrench, then hold the crank there to keep it under tension while you tighten the pinch bolts.

I'm not sure how clear my description was, but basically you can use the crank arm against an object stuck into that hole to gain leverage.
